Get to Know Delaware

Delaware, the second smallest state in the United States, is often referred to as the "First State" due to its status as the first to ratify the U.S. Constitution. Despite its modest size, Delaware is packed with attractions that appeal to a variety of travelers. For history enthusiasts, Delaware offers an array of historical landmarks and museums. The cobblestone streets of New Castle, with its well-preserved colonial architecture, transport visitors back to the 17th century. The First State National Historical Park tells the story of Delaware's role in the early history of the United States, and the Air Mobility Command Museum showcases an impressive collection of vintage aircraft. Beachgoers will find their haven along Delaware's Atlantic coast. Rehoboth Beach is a popular destination with a classic boardwalk, charming boutiques, and family-friendly activities. Nearby, Cape Henlopen State Park offers beautiful beaches, walking trails, and the opportunity to explore Fort Miles, a World War II coastal defense site. Nature lovers can revel in the state's outdoor offerings. The Delaware Water Gap on the border with Pennsylvania is a stunning natural retreat perfect for hiking, canoeing, and wildlife watching. Trap Pond State Park features the northernmost natural stand of bald cypress trees, and its serene waters are ideal for kayaking and fishing. For those interested in the arts, the Delaware Art Museum in Wilmington boasts a significant collection of American art and illustration, as well as a beautiful sculpture garden. The Grand Opera House, also in Wilmington, is a restored 19th-century theater that hosts a variety of performances throughout the year. Delaware's culinary scene is a hidden gem, with an emphasis on fresh, local ingredients. The state's agricultural bounty is on full display at farmers' markets and in the farm-to-table restaurants that dot the landscape. Seafood lovers will particularly enjoy the fresh catches from the Delaware Bay, especially the local blue crabs. Shopping is another draw, as Delaware is famously tax-free, making it an excellent destination for those looking to indulge in some retail therapy. From the upscale shops of Greenville to the expansive Christiana Mall, there's something for every shopper. In essence, Delaware's diverse offerings from historical sites and natural beauty to cultural experiences and tax-free shopping make it a destination that, while small in size, is rich in attractions. Whether you're seeking a quiet beach getaway, a deep dive into American history, or a nature escape, Delaware provides a memorable and varied travel experience.
Delaware, nestled in the Mid-Atlantic region of the United States, experiences a temperate climate with four distinct seasons, each offering its own unique appeal to visitors. Winter, from December to February, can be quite cold with average temperatures ranging from the low 30s to mid-40s Fahrenheit. Snowfall varies, with the northern parts of the state receiving more than the southern coastal areas. While it's not the peak season for tourists, the winter landscape can be serene and beautiful, especially after a fresh snowfall. Spring, from March to May, brings a gradual warming trend with temperatures ranging from the upper 40s to the high 60s. This season is marked by blooming flowers and increasingly sunny days, making it a delightful time for outdoor activities. Precipitation is fairly evenly distributed throughout the year, but spring showers are common, so packing a light rain jacket is advisable. Summer, from June to August, is the warmest and most popular time to visit Delaware. Temperatures often hover in the 80s, but can occasionally reach the 90s, accompanied by moderate to high humidity. The coastal areas offer a refreshing breeze, making beach visits particularly enjoyable. Summer is also the season for outdoor festivals, water sports, and enjoying the state's beautiful beaches. Autumn, from September to November, is a favorite for many due to the comfortable temperatures, ranging from the low 60s to the mid-70s. The humidity drops, and the changing foliage provides a stunning backdrop for hiking and scenic drives. It's an excellent time to explore the state's parks and historic sites without the summer crowds. The most pleasant weather conditions are typically found in late spring and early autumn, when temperatures are moderate, humidity is lower, and the natural scenery is at its most vibrant. Whether you're looking to enjoy the outdoors or explore the cultural offerings of cities like Wilmington and Dover, these seasons offer an ideal climate for a wide range of activities.
Delaware, the second smallest state in the United States, offers a rich tapestry of cultural experiences that cater to lovers of the arts, history, and local customs. Despite its size, Delaware is packed with museums, historical sites, and a vibrant arts scene that will delight any cultural enthusiast. Begin your exploration at the Delaware Art Museum in Wilmington, which boasts an impressive collection of American art and illustration from the 19th to the 21st century, including a significant holding of works by Howard Pyle and his students. The museum also features the largest collection of British Pre-Raphaelite art outside of the United Kingdom. For a deep dive into history, visit the Winterthur Museum, Garden and Library, the former estate of Henry Francis du Pont. This premier museum of American decorative arts displays an unrivaled collection of nearly 90,000 objects made or used in America up to the 1860s. The estate also offers a 60-acre naturalistic garden, perfect for a serene stroll. Live music thrives in Delaware, with the Grand Opera House in Wilmington being a centerpiece for performances ranging from classical to contemporary. The Clifford Brown Jazz Festival, held annually in Wilmington, is a tribute to the late jazz trumpeter and a must-attend event for jazz lovers. The First State National Historical Park tells the story of Delaware's role in the history of the United States, with multiple sites including the New Castle Court House Museum, where the state's colonial assembly declared independence from Pennsylvania and Great Britain. Art galleries are scattered throughout the state, with the Rehoboth Art League in Rehoboth Beach offering exhibitions, classes, and events that celebrate the arts. The league's historic campus is a charming spot to appreciate the works of regional artists. Local customs and traditions can be experienced at the many festivals and events throughout the year. The Dover Days Festival is one of the longest-running and commemorates Delaware's heritage with parades, maypole dancing, and colonial craftsmen. For a taste of local cuisine, the Delaware Seafood Festival showcases the state's fresh catches and culinary expertise. Delaware's cultural offerings are as diverse as they are rich. From the cobblestone streets of historic New Castle to the modern performances at the Freeman Stage at Bayside, the state provides a full spectrum of cultural experiences. Whether you're exploring the legacy of the du Pont family or enjoying the local flavors at a seaside eatery, Delaware's cultural scene is sure to enchant and inspire.
Delaware, the second-smallest state in the United States, is packed with attractions that are perfect for families traveling with children. From its beautiful beaches to its rich history and interactive museums, Delaware offers a variety of experiences that will delight and educate young minds. Start your adventure at the Delaware Children's Museum in Wilmington, where hands-on exhibits encourage kids to climb, build, and explore. The museum's interactive displays cover topics from the power of water to the basics of engineering, ensuring that there's something to spark the curiosity of every child. For outdoor fun, head to one of Delaware's many state parks. Cape Henlopen State Park, with its beautiful beaches and historic WWII observation towers, offers a unique combination of recreation and education. Children can swim, hike, and even participate in nature programs to learn about the local ecosystem. The Brandywine Zoo, located in beautiful Brandywine Park in Wilmington, is home to a variety of animals from around the world. It's small enough for little legs to walk around without getting tired but diverse enough to keep their interest. The zoo also offers educational programs and special events throughout the year. If your children are fascinated by trains, don't miss the Wilmington & Western Railroad. This heritage railway offers themed train rides throughout the year, including special events like the Easter Bunny Express and the Autumn Leaf Special, which are sure to be a hit with the kids. For a day of thrills, take the family to Funland in Rehoboth Beach. This amusement park has been a family favorite since 1962 and features rides and games suitable for all ages, from classic carousels to more adventurous bumper cars and slides. History buffs will enjoy a visit to Historic New Castle, where the cobblestone streets and colonial buildings feel like a step back in time. The New Castle Court House Museum, which served as Delaware's colonial capitol, offers a glimpse into America's past and is an educational experience for children. Finally, no trip to Delaware would be complete without a visit to the beach. Rehoboth Beach is not only a great place for sunbathing and swimming, but it also has a boardwalk lined with shops, eateries, and arcades that are sure to entertain the entire family. Delaware may be small, but it's filled with big adventures for families. With its combination of educational attractions, outdoor activities, and family-friendly entertainment, it's a state that offers memorable experiences for visitors of all ages.
Delaware may be the second-smallest state in the United States, but it boasts a surprising array of natural wonders and outdoor activities that are perfect for nature enthusiasts. From serene beaches to wildlife-rich wetlands, Delaware offers a peaceful retreat for those looking to connect with the great outdoors. Start your journey at Cape Henlopen State Park, where the Atlantic Ocean meets the Delaware Bay. This park is a haven for beachgoers, fishermen, and history buffs alike. Its sandy shores are perfect for sunbathing and swimming, while the fishing pier is a popular spot for catching dinner. The park also features a network of trails, including the scenic Pinelands Nature Trail, which meanders through maritime forests and coastal dunes. For bird watchers and nature photographers, the Bombay Hook National Wildlife Refuge is an absolute must-visit. This 16,000-acre refuge along the Delaware Bay estuary is one of the largest remaining expanses of tidal salt marsh in the region. It's a critical stopover for migratory birds, especially during the spring and fall migrations. Visitors can explore the refuge via a 12-mile wildlife drive and several walking trails. Another gem is the Prime Hook National Wildlife Refuge, which offers a similar experience with its marshes, ponds, and woodlands. It's a sanctuary for waterfowl and shorebirds, and the serene environment makes it an ideal spot for kayaking and canoeing. For a more active adventure, head to the trails of White Clay Creek State Park. With over 37 miles of trails, this park is a paradise for hikers, mountain bikers, and horseback riders. The trails wind through lush valleys and along the namesake creek, offering picturesque views and a chance to spot local wildlife. If you're looking for a unique outdoor experience, consider a visit to the Killens Pond State Park, centered around a 66-acre millpond. The park features a water park for family fun, but also offers tranquil nature trails, fishing, boating, and a high ropes adventure course. Lastly, for a coastal experience with a twist, explore the Delaware Seashore State Park, which is surrounded by water on all sides. Here, you can indulge in surf fishing, windsurfing, or simply enjoy the miles of pristine beaches. Delaware's natural landscapes may be compact, but they are incredibly diverse. Whether you're looking to relax on the beach, observe wildlife in their natural habitat, or embark on a hiking or biking adventure, Delaware's outdoor offerings are sure to enchant and rejuvenate any nature lover.
Delaware, the second smallest state in the United States, offers a variety of transportation options for visitors. While it may not have the same extensive transit systems as larger cities, getting around is still quite manageable. Travelers typically arrive in Delaware by car, as it is well-connected by major highways like I-95, which runs through the northern part of the state. For those flying in, the Wilmington Airport (ILG) serves the area, though it is smaller and offers fewer flights compared to nearby major airports such as Philadelphia International Airport (PHL), which is just a short drive away. Additionally, the Baltimore-Washington International Airport (BWI) and the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) are also within reasonable driving distance. Train travel is another option, with Amtrak serving Wilmington and Newark through the Northeast Corridor, providing easy access to cities like Washington D.C., Philadelphia, New York City, and Boston. For those arriving by sea, nearby ports in Baltimore and Philadelphia accommodate cruise ship passengers. Within Delaware, DART First State operates buses that cover much of the state, including local routes in Wilmington, Dover, and beach areas. However, service can be less frequent in rural areas, so it's important to plan ahead. Renting a car is often the most convenient way to explore Delaware, especially for visiting attractions that are spread out, such as the various state parks, beaches, and historic sites. 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ft are also available, particularly in the more populated areas. For those who prefer to cycle, Delaware offers a number of scenic bike trails, including the Junction and Breakwater Trail that connects Lewes and Rehoboth Beach. In the beach towns, biking can be a pleasant way to get around, especially during the summer months when traffic is heavier. As for walkability, it varies depending on where you are in Delaware. Downtown Wilmington is quite walkable, with attractions, restaurants, and shops within easy reach. The same goes for the historic districts of cities like New Castle and the boardwalks of beach towns such as Rehoboth Beach, which are best enjoyed on foot. In summary, Delaware's transportation options cater to a variety of preferences, whether you're arriving by plane, train, or automobile. While public transit is available, having a car will give you the most flexibility to explore all that the state has to offer. Walkability is location-dependent, with some areas more pedestrian-friendly than others.
